Why Push Alerts Are Essential for Mobile-Only Parishioners

Not all members visit websites or check email. Many don’t even attend Mass in person every week due to health, distance, or work. For them, push alerts are the church’s voice reaching their pocket at the right moment.

Push notifications via a dedicated app for church ensure that:

  • Members receive urgent updates without delay

  • Announcements and reminders don’t get buried in inboxes

  • Prayer times, scripture readings, and liturgical notes arrive instantly

  • Every parishioner stays spiritually and socially connected even if they’re not physically present

Push Alerts in Action

Here are some real-world use cases:

  • Mass Time Changes – Notify members instantly about last-minute schedule updates

  • Prayer Requests – Alert users to urgent intentions submitted by community members

  • Faith Formation Reminders – Prompt catechism students or parents about upcoming sessions

  • Donation Drives – Encourage giving by sending real-time stewardship updates with direct links

  • Diocesan Messages – Broadcast bishop communications directly to parishioners' devices
